Bottled water sales have tripled over the last 10 years, partly because of the widening concern about the quality of tap water as well as convincing marketing assurance that bottled water is pure and safe to drink. But the truth is, somewhere between 25 – 40% of all bottled water is actually, bottled tap water.
Although the FDA has rules to prevent misleading claims of water purity, some bottlers will still label their product as “spring water” even though it was pumped out of a well and may be chemically treated.
